An iterative method for computation of time-optimal control of quasilinear systems

V. M. Aleksandrov

Sobolev Institute of Mathematics, Siberian Branch of the Russian Academy of Sciences

Abstract: An iterative method of finding the time-optimal control for quasi-linear systems is considered. A system of linear algebraic equations is obtained, which relates deviations of the initial conditions of the normalized conjugate system and the deviation of the finite time to the deviations of phase coordinates resulted from nonlinearity. A numerical algorithm and its modifications are described. The convergence of the iterative procedure has been proved. Some examples are presented.
